  • India’s slumping economy could hurt Modi’s re-election bid

    Slumping economy? We thought they were all tech geniuses? Cut off their visas, which is how India remits billions out of the US economy and their economy collapses. Without a […]

  • Defeating HR1044

    “This is a key priority. A key ally are the many organizations of workers from other countries, who will be locked out of employment-based green cards by the Indians and […]